Dungannon get third win in a row

Dungannon handed their new coach Jeremy Davidson the ideal early Christmas present with a third consecutive win, defeating an under strength Galwegians side 37-3 at Stevenson Park.

Full back John McGuckian, their top scorer for the season, hit two rangy penalties over in the opening half for a 6-3 lead, with young David Delaney replying for the Connacht side.

Dungannon scorched off the blocks in the second half with a try four minutes in from Paul Magee, quickly added to by a second from Andy Hughes, with both being converted by McGuckian.

Further tries followed from lock Neil Patterson and a second for Magee eased Davidson's charges home for a bonus point win which sees them up to tenth in the table.

Scorers: Dungannon: Tries: P Magee 2, A Hughes, N Patterson; Con: J McGuckian 4; Pen: J McGuckian 3

Galwegians: Pen: D Delaney
